Book-loving residents of and visitors to the city of Portland, Ore., are already familiar with the legendary labyrinthine charms of Powell's City of Books, the largest new-and-used bookstore in the world. Powells.com, the online equivalent of this bibliophile's paradise, brings the Powell's experience to the Web including a bestseller list that reflects the eclectic tastes of Powell's customers.
